This book introduces students to the distinct legal traditions that make up the South African legal system. South Africa's official legal system comprises a number of distinct legal traditions: a common-law mix of transplanted European laws, as well as traditional community laws, collectively known as customary law, while aspects of the personal laws of Hinduism, Judaism and Islam are being increasingly recognised. This book introduces law students to the rich and complex legal culture that underpins our constitutional democracy.

Christa Rautenbach has more than 30 years of experience as a legal scientist. She holds the following degrees: B luris (cum laude), LLB (cum laude), LLM and LLD. She was a public prosecutor in the employ of the Department of Justice before she became an academic scholar at the Faculty of Law, North-West University (Potchefstroom), where she is a Full Professor. She also holds a number of other positions such as honorary treasurer of the Society of Law Teachers of Southern Africa, secretary of Juris Diversitas and Ambassador Scientist of the Alexander von Humboldt Foundation. In addition, she serves on the Board of the Commission on Legal Pluralism and on the Advisory Board of the African-German Network of Excellence in Science (AGNES).
